Why Choose Procurement in the Post Crisis Environment Training Course?
Procurement Training for Post Crisis Environment has become a necessity as organisations navigate the aftermath of global disruptions that fundamentally reshaped supply chains. The last few years revealed unprecedented vulnerabilities—from pandemic-related shutdowns and demand fluctuations to climate-driven events and geopolitical instability. These disruptions highlighted the essential role of procurement in safeguarding organisational continuity, strengthening supplier resilience, and securing long-term sustainability.
This Procurement Course for Post Crisis Environment demonstrates how procurement has moved from a transactional function to a strategic driver of value, resilience, and competitive advantage. Using the course outline for context, participants explore how procurement teams must adapt their practices to thrive in volatile markets. Topics include supplier risk management, relationship building, contract adaptability, upstream vulnerability assessment, and continuous improvement across procurement operations. The course emphasises why procurement excellence—and not simply operational efficiency—determines an organisation’s ability to withstand future crises.
Throughout the Procurement in the Post Crisis Environment Training Course, delegates examine how enhanced supplier collaboration, data-driven decision-making, and strategic contracting contribute to strong performance in the “new normal.” Participants learn to rethink supplier engagement, redesign risk mitigation strategies, and establish procurement approaches that reinforce business resilience. By applying these principles, professionals return equipped to build stronger supply chains, improve procurement effectiveness, and position their organisations for sustainable long-term success.

The Course Content
- How the world changed due to the Pandemic, The Demand spike and ongoing supply chain disruptions
- What is the purpose of a business?
- Dealing with the Problem of being a “go between”
- Purchasing Process and Cycle of Procurement
- Positioning Purchasing within the Company
- The Global Supply Chain
- Analysing Value
- Conditioning the Supplier to Meet Your Requirement
- Life Cycle Costing
- The Total Cost Approach to Purchasing
- Using Price Indices
- Performance Evaluation
- Is your relationship transactional or outcome-based?
- Defining desired outcomes that are measurable
- Developing an effective outsourcing contract
- Designing a resilient supply chain
- Evaluating cost/service trade-offs
- Internal supply chain risks
- PESTLE and external risks
- Risk management principles
- Evaluation and prioritisation of risks
- Contingency and risk management planning
- How The Supply Chain Crises changed our practices regarding Risk
- Rationale and approach to performance management including Lean
- Identifying, defining, and tracking your metrics
- Incentives and continuous improvement
- Re-engineering supply chains end to end to become resilient
- Organisation development
